Output 662e17bad101161e53275ee6f20d57dd5ae0e228ee8422a1040052580a805545:3

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b858de3bf97c66376685ed4231df1d2a39bc357 OP_EQUAL
address
38aLbSg2RJmCNedk7H8YYUDuKJqZ788z6w
transaction
662e17bad101161e53275ee6f20d57dd5ae0e228ee8422a1040052580a805545
spent
true